Afghanistan, Feb. 22 -- Health authorities in Badghis Province have confirmed the first case of polio this year in the Bala Murghab district.
Mohammad Yousuf Najmi, the General Director of the Collective Immunization Department in Badghis, stated on Friday, February 21, that the positive polio case was recorded in the "Quruto" area of Bala Murghab district.
According to the Health Department official in Badghis, the virus was detected in the body of a five-year-old girl. This marks the first reported case of polio in the province this year.
This comes as the World Health Organization has raised concerns about the increasing number of polio cases in both Afghanistan and Pakistan.
